Recurrent primary pulmonary anaplastic B-cell lymphoma in a 35-year-old patient treated with radical resection: A case report.
Background: Primary pulmonary lymphoma (PPL) is a lymphoid proliferation in the lung parenchyma and/or bronchi of a patient with no extrapulmonary lesion within 3 months of diagnosis.
